JOHN ABRAHAM HERAUD BIOGRAPHY

JOHN ABRAHAM HERAUD BIOGRAPHY from the Biographical Dictionary of English Literature by John Cousin.

HERAUD, JOHN ABRAHAM (1799-1887). —Poet, born in London, of Huguenot descent, he contributed to various periodicals, and pub. two poems, which attracted some attention, The Descent into Hell (1830), and The Judgment of the Flood (1834). He also produced a few plays, miscellaneous poems, books of travel, etc.
